About this experience
This Las Vegas Pool Party crawl is VIP all the way. Get VIP hosted entry into 2 of the best Dayclub venues in Las Vegas (cover charges included). Also, enjoy a 45 minute tour of the Las Vegas Strip aboard our air conditioned party bus. During the party bus ride, you get to cruise the world famous Las Vegas Strip, dance on the stripper pole & listen to bumping music. Fun in the sun!
What's included
Included
- Mixed cocktails while in the party bus
- Cover charges to get into venues
- Bottled water
- Fast Pass Entry
- In-vehicle air conditioning
- VIP Host
Not included
- Lunch
- Snacks
- Cabanas & seating inside venue
- Alcohols beverages inside venues
- Hotel pick-up and drop off
- Gratuities

What are the best things to do in Las Vegas?
+
Las Vegas sells two trips at once: the Strip after dark, and the red-rock desert that starts twenty minutes past the last casino. Helicopter runs to the Grand Canyon, Hoover Dam half-days and Red Rock Canyon drives all leave early, while show tickets, speakeasy crawls and high-roller dining fill the evening. Outty Ranking weighs operator reliability heavily here, because the gap between a well-run desert tour and a coach-and-queue version is enormous. When is the best time to visit Las Vegas?
+
October to April. Summer highs above 105F make midday outdoor tours punishing. Booking patterns follow the same curve: prices and queues climb in peak weeks, while shoulder season gives you better availability on the top-ranked experiences and more room to change plans.
How many days do you need in Las Vegas?
+
Three full days covers the headline sights without sprinting. A workable rhythm is one anchor experience each morning, such as this one, an unhurried afternoon in a single neighborhood, then a food or nightlife booking in the evening. Five days lets you add a day trip outside the city.
